Job Title: Service Crew

FLSA Status: FT - E

Reports to: Service Crew Leader

Rate of Pay: $325/ weekly

Closing Date: 1/31/2026

Benefits: Standard; Part-Time, Non-Exempt employees are eligible for but not limited to the following:

  • Sick leave benefit – 1 day per month, 12 sick days per year (accrual and availability begins at hire; sick time accrual is pro-rated for part-time hours.)

General Duties

  • Attend and participate in evening programs and spiritual activities.
  • Maintain a standard of cleanliness in personal grooming and in living quarters.
  • Assist with the clean-up of the total camp at the end of each session and at the conclusion of the summer.
  • Assist with evening cabin activities.
  • Attend and participate in Staff Orientation.
  • Attend and participate in all camp wide activities, campfires, staff meetings and staff devotions
  • Assist with Camper check-in and check-out.

Specific Duties

Safety and Supervision

  • Enforce, and abide by, all camp policies and procedures
  • Responsible for the health and well-being of self and campers.
  • Maintain the utmost level of safety for staff and campers at all times
  • Practice and enforce all camp safety regulations and emergency procedures.
  • Maintain group/staff control at specialized group activities so that other support staff can focus on safety.
  • Ensure compliance with American Camping Association standards of safety and programmatic conduct at all times.
  • Coordinate and implement all program components relative to the daily schedule in a timely fashion.
  • Attend relevant in-service trainings.

Weekly Responsibilities

  • Report to the Service Crew Leader and follow instructions for daily tasks as assigned.
  • Assist in the maintenance of High Peak Camp by;
  • Emptying all outdoor and indoor common trash receptacles.
  • Maintain camp lawns and landscaping.
  • Provide general building maintenance.
  • Maintain trails.
  • Other tasks as needed.
  • Setup and clean up of camp fires.
  • Assist with programming of all campfire programs.
  • These may include messy games, skits, and songs for campers.
  • Take part is special camp property projects.
  • Set and clear tables before and after each meal.
  • Serve food during assigned meals.
  • Assist in dining room preparation for each camp session.
  • Assist in dish rooms duties as assigned.
  • Clean dishes and dish room floors after each meal.
  • Deliver program supplies as needed to program areas.
  • Assist in camper supervision under the direction of other staff members.
  • Perform all other duties and roles assigned by the Director and Assistant Director.

Qualifications And Education Requirements

  • 15 years of age (by May 1st)
  • Ability to following through with assigned tasks.
  • Has a strong work ethic and ability to follow procedures.
  • Flexible attitude.
  • Maintain a high standard of personal and communal living and behaviors.
  • Must have or obtain ServSafe certification at time of employment.
  • Be supportive of The Salvation Army’s mission. Ability to reflect and model the high standards of our organization as one of the world’s most distinguished human services charitable organizations.

Physical Requirements

Ability to walk, stand, bend, squat, climb, kneel, and twist on an intermittent or continuous basis. Ability to grasp, push, pull, and reach overhead. Ability to operate telephone. Ability to lift to 50 pounds. Ability to work at height while harnessed at 50 or more feet from the ground. Ability to access and produce information from the computer. Ability to understand written information. Qualified individuals must be able to perform the essential duties of the position with or without accommodation.
